Regarding legal heir/representative assessee

This query is : Resolved 

01 December 2011 Dear Sir,

One of my friend's mother died recently & after her demise the refund of IT for A.Y.2010-11 has came now.

Now in this regard i want to know how this refund he can get encashed as her sign is required on reverse of chq.

Pls guide.Also provide legal formalities to be done in this regard.Is their any IT form availbal.

Thanks

02 December 2011 Firstly the signature required on the reverse of the cheque is that of the depositor.

So you can sign on the reverse.

However, you will be able to deposit the cheque only in the account number mentioned on the refund cheque.
